If Sussex Central wanted to avenge their loss from the last time they played Southampton, they should've done a better job of containing Zayden Pope. The Southampton Indians put the hurt on the Sussex Central Tigers with a sharp 75-53 win on Friday thanks to Pope, who went 13-for-18 on his way to 30 points and four steals. Those 30 points gave him a new career-high.
The team also got some help courtesy of Israel Key, who posted ten points in addition to eight assists and three steals. He is on a roll when it comes to steals, as he's now grabbed two or more in each of the last three games he's played.
Southampton's record now sits at 15-4. As for Sussex Central, they are on a four-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 8-9.
Southampton did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next matchup, a 75-27 victory against Appomattox Regional Governor's Arts & Tech on the 10th. As for Sussex Central, they have also already played their next contest, a 42-40 loss against Westmoreland on the 8th.
